The goal of Living Free is to provide the highest quality mental health
care for individuals, couples and families experiencing social, emotional
and/or behavioral problems. Living Free is designed to help clients
attain, enhance or re-establish their overall mental health.
The target population is males and females, ages 13 through adulthood
who have problems with mood disorders, anxiety and stress, crisis,
co-dependency issues, compulsion disorders (gambling, sex and spending),
adjustment disorders including adjustment to acute and chronic illness,
marital conflict, parent-child conflict, family issues, low self-esteen,
post traumatic stress and HIV issues.
The services at Living Free are provided by a team of professionals
including social workers, professional counselors, nurse clinical specialists,
doctorate and masters level therapists as well as certified hypnotherapists.
Treatment plans are designed in collaboration with the clients using
a multidisciplinary approach to address the individualized needs of
each client.
Living Free offers Individual, Group, Couples and Family therapy.
Emphasis is put on the identification of treatment issues and the development
of strong "life skills" necessary for effective living. A
variety of treatment approaches are used according to the client's individual
needs. In addition to traditional individual, family and group therapy
approaches, Living Free offers Hypnotherapy by Certified Practitioners
